DTC P0300: Random Misfire Detected

- Using scan tool, check Crankshaft Position (CKP) sensor pulse width (item 22) while maintaining a constant RPM. If pulse width is constant, go to next step. If pulse width is not constant, go to step 5).
- Check wiring harness between CKP sensor and PCM. Repair wiring harness as necessary. Go to step 12). If wiring harness is okay, go to next step.
- Check CKP sensor and PCM connectors for damage. Repair or replace connectors as necessary. Go to step 12). If connectors are okay, go to next step.
- Ensure CKP sensor and sensing plate are properly installed. Correct installation as necessary. Go to step 12). If CKP sensor and sensing plate are installed properly, replace CKP sensor. Go to step 12).
- Ensure engine coolant temperature is at 68°F (20°C). Disconnect each fuel injector connector. Using DVOM, check resistance across fuel injector terminals. If resistance is not 13-16 ohms replace fuel injector(s). Go to step 12). If resistance is as specified, go to next step.
- Inspect wiring harness between each fuel injector and PCM. Repair wiring harness as necessary. Go to step 12). If wiring harness is okay, go to next step.
- Inspect fuel injectors and PCM connectors for damage. Repair or replace connectors as necessary. Go to step 12). If connectors are okay, go to next step.
- Using scan tool, check long-term fuel compensation (item 81). If long-term fuel trim value is -12.5-12.5 at 2500 RPM after engine is warmed up, go to next step. If not, go to DTC P0170 and DTC P0173 test.
- Using scan tool, check short-term fuel compensation (item 82). Short-term fuel trim value at 2500 RPM should be -10.0-10.0 on 2.4L or -30-25 on 3.0L after engine is warmed up. If value is as specified, go to next step. If not as specified, go to DTC P0170 and DTC P0173 test.
- Using a thermometer, check engine compartment ambient temperature. Using scan tool, read ECT sensor temperature (item 21). Compare both readings. If readings are not about the same, go to DTC P0115 test. If readings are about the same, go to next step.
- Inspect following items:
- Check ignition coil, spark plugs and spark plug cables.
- Check engine compression.
- Check for skipped timing belt.
- Check EGR valve (Federal vehicles). Go to DTC P0400 test. Repair or replace item(s) as necessary. Go to next step. If no faults are found, go to next step.
- Road test vehicle and attempt to duplicate conditions that caused original complaint. Recheck for DTCs. If no DTCs are displayed, test is complete.
